Who Is Elena Bosgana-Stanford?

Elena Bosgana is a key player for the Stanford Cardinal women’s basketball team. As a guard, she has made significant contributions to her team’s success.

Elena is known for her impressive skills on the court, combining athleticism and strategic thinking.

Originally from Greece, Elena attended the American Community School of Athens. Her background includes a rigorous academic and athletic training that prepared her well for college basketball.

Elena has been part of Stanford’s roster since the 2021-22 season. During her time with Stanford, she has earned several accolades, including being a two-time Pac-12 champion and a member of the Pac-12 Academic Honor Roll.

In the 2022-23 season, she helped her team to a dominating win over Cal Poly, where she matched her career-high with 15 points and also grabbed seven rebounds. This performance solidified her role as a pivotal player for Stanford.
